→ Пошук по сайту       Увійти / Зареєструватися

2.3.4. Система анализа ответа (высказываний)

Мы будем рассматривать анализ ответов на примере авторской системы Дельфин, разработанной в МЭИ (ТУ).
К каждому контрольному заданию присоединяется список эталонов ответа. Каждый эталон обладает набором свойств. К свойствам эталона относятся – тип ввода, тип эталона, сам эталон, вес ошибки, связь с другими элементами (кадрами) курса. Для определенных типов эталонов некоторые свойства могут быть опущены.

Свойство тип ввода определяет тип и разновидность устройства ввода, посредством которого ожидается ввод ответа. Они описаны выше. Типы эталонов:

число:

  • тип числа и точность по эталону;
  • число в диапазоне;
  • любое число;

слово, фраза:

  • полное совпадение;
  • слово, фраза без учета шрифта;
  • логическое выражение с «ключевыми» словами;

выражение (формула):

  • алгебраическое выражение;
  • любое алгебраическое выражение;
  • логическое выражение;
  • любое логическое выражение.

ситуация:

  • Преобразовать в алгебраическое выражение. Введенная обучаемым ситуация и эталоны преобразуются в однострочные алгебраические выражения с применением общепринятых правил математики. Затем система анализа высказываний проверяет эквивалентность ответа и одного из эталонов;
  • Преобразовать в строку. Введенная обучаемым ситуация и эталоны преобразуются в строки для последующего сравнения;
  • Классификация по областям. Перемещение элементов в заданные области. Например, разместить хищников и травоядных по разным клеткам;
  • Анализ взаиморасположения объектов в пространстве;
  • Анализ последовательности изменения объектов.

Эталон представляет либо строку, либо указатель на таблицу элементов ситуации.

Каждому эталону соответствует понятие «Вес ошибки», т.е. автор – разработчик учебного курса оценивает правильность введенного ответа в соответствии с данным эталоном.

Связь с другими элементами (кадрами) курса указывает, куда надо перейти, если произошло совпадение с эталоном. Обязательно надо ввести связь по «Иначе», т.е. указать, куда надо перейти, если не произошло совпадения ни с одним эталоном. Для задания это всевозможные варианты ответов (обычно ошибочных), не перечисленные в списке эталонов. Для такого псевдоэталона также необходимо назначить вес ошибки.

Структура системы ввода и анализа высказываний

Рисунок 2.3.1 Структура системы ввода и анализа высказываний

Система анализа в Дельфине построена как простая система искусственного интеллекта, работающая с базой знаний по элементарной математике и логике. В результате последовательного анализа ответа и набора эталонов делается вывод о соответствии ответа одному из эталонов или ни одному из них.

загрузка...
Сторінки, близькі за змістом